ADS Export to Origin converter

最近在準備一些學校報告用的投影片,在學長主持的小咪報告之後,學長表示

你這幾頁的圖,如果之後要放論文的話,就乾脆用Origin重畫

好吧學長都這樣說了,就來畫畫Origin的圖wwww
不過秉持著用開源軟體的精神,還是找了一下,結果就在的作敏學長的blog 裡面找到 qtiplot 這個開源繪圖軟體 ,跟Origin的功能幾乎差不多。

...

影評:地心引力 Gravity

still

總評:

7/10

浪費時間
看看就好
值得一看
非看不可

...

使用Expect進行大量修改密碼

最近稍微研究了一下expect這個工具,簡單來說,它可以作為使用者對shell的代言人,本來需要大量使用者回應的工作,可以交由expect來處理, 能做到非常多事情,多到值得寫一本書,也是本篇的參考資料:
Exploring Expect A Tcl-based Toolkit for Automating Interactive Programs
看書還是吸收技術最快的方法。

...

使用gnu make編譯Qt 專案

最近白天跑EM,夜深寫QT。
當然這完全沒什麼,其他同學至少兩年前就寫過了LOL。

只能說Qt 真是相當強大的工具,最基本的signal & slot的概念,如果對GTK的callback熟悉的話,很快就能上手。
一般在寫Qt時,最常用的還是用qmake來產生Makefile,畢竟qmake寫得還不賴,打一次就會產生好Makefile,接著make即可; 不過有時個人習慣還是偏好用gnu-make,可以自己編寫Makefile,做一些細部的調整,用qmake的話只要重新產生一次Makefile,這些細部調整就要重新再修改一次。
這篇就是說明一下,要如何使用gnu-make來處理Qt專案。

...

你會拒絕政府的好意嗎?

最近許多事情佔據了新聞版面:國軍虐死案、大埔拆屋案,然後是一些媒體刻意掩蓋的台北違法抓人事件,這些都是政府在迫害人民的案例。

...

 August 1, 2013 |    Comment  |    Comment  | 1014 字  |  YodaLee

使用差動雙投擲計時器應用於時鐘製作之研製

minecraft是一款我認為設計得相當好的遊戲,透過簡單方塊的堆積,讓你組出任何你想要的內容;而紅石又是其中最有變化的物件,可以模擬出許多數位電路的行為,老實說基本的邏輯設計課程應該可以用minecraft當作輔助教材(XD)。

minecraft升級到1.5之後,多了很多新的紅石元件,其中包括可以測定日光強度的日光sensor,讓我們有機會在minecraft當中,實現時鐘的功能。
之前已經有相當多相關的設計,包括直接用 sensor 輸出信號接在 redstone lamp (1) ,及用長線分離出各時段的信號[(2)](#reference 等。
因為sensor輸出信號在白天呈現山形,第一種時鐘,共有上午和下午時會呈現相同的時間、計時非線性、晚上也只能顯示為晚上而非確切時間等問題;第二種則需要相當大的空間和電路,在一般server不用creative mode難以實現。 這裡我們就要設計的是,能夠線性計時,利用daylight sensor來校正,同時體積儘量小的設計。

...

影評:星際爭霸戰-闇黑無界 Star Trek XII Into the darkness

still

總評:

5.5/10

浪費時間
看看就好
值得一看
非看不可

...

Office Word 長篇文章技巧

Office word是我認為M$數一數二成功的產品之一,透過所視即所得的介面,讓人更能快速的編輯文件,市佔率至少超過90%;如果是編個幾頁的文件,也許可以直接打一打即可,但要是要打個幾十到幾百頁的文件的話,就必須善用一些word本來的功能,確保無論如何修改,整份文件都能符合正確的格式。
個人其實也有在用LaTeX編一些文件,無論在排版的變化、格式化文件的引入、字型呈現、數學式的表現等,LaTeX許多功能是word完全無排匹敵的,這系列文章並不是試圖用 word 挑戰 LaTeX 的地位,只是介紹一些 word 常被忽略的功能,讓word在長文件上發揮它該有的效力。

...

用makefile來編譯安裝android apps

因為一些關係,最近正在寫Android上的Apps。
寫Android,大部分人可能都會用Eclipse來寫,Eclipse主要是整合了很多功能,用起來滿方便的,不過個人還是偏好用terminal+vim來寫code。
雖然這樣會比較不那麼自動一點,但也不是沒有解,在終端機下,如果有什麼要自動化的話,就要用makefile啦。

...

使用vimdiff來解決git merge conflict

最近同時家裡用筆電跟辦公室用桌電,在兩個地方使用 git/github 來管理程式作業,這兩個東西加起來根本神物,本來要用隨身碟同步的東西,現在可以用 git 直接完成。
關於git的基本介紹我就不解釋了,網路上隨便一找就有一堆資源,我當初是看 progit 來學git。
用 git 會遇到的問題是:有時候檔案在github上的檔案已經更新,本地的檔案也有修改過,這時候若想要 git pull 的話會產生conflict,這時候就需要把本地的檔案刪掉重新clone使用merge來解決衝突,偏偏作者手殘常常把檔案 merge 成連«<, »>都保留下來的檔案,相當麻煩;這次好好的研究一下怎麼用vimdiff作為merge的工具,在這裡記錄一下。

...